Staff Product Manager, Growth Bets

Robinhood Robinhood · Fintech · Menlo Park, CA +1 · Growth Activation Engagement and Gold

Robinhood is seeking a Staff Product Manager to lead a zero-to-one charter focused on identifying, incubating, and launching new growth initiatives. The role involves defining strategy, leading cross-functional teams, and using experimentation and analytics to build growth loops for user acquisition and retention. The ideal candidate has extensive experience in product management and growth expertise, with a strong combination of product intuition and analytical discipline.

What you'd actually do

  1. Identify, incubate, and launch zero-to-one growth bets that create step-function change in how Robinhood acquires and retains net new users
  2. Define the strategy and roadmap for a new, dedicated growth charter that sits beyond our traditional PLG motion
  3. Lead a collaborative team of engineers, designers, data scientists, marketers, and researchers to take initiatives from idea to launch
  4. Design and build growth loops that compound acquisition and retention over time
  5. Use experimentation, analytics, and tight partnership with data scientists to ruthlessly prioritize, measure traction quickly, and decide when to scale or when to pivot

Skills

Required

  • Bachelor's or Master's Degree, or equivalent practical experience
  • 8+ years of product management experience building high-quality consumer products
  • Growth expertise: Multiple years working across the growth funnel—acquisition, activation, resurrection, and/or retention. You're deeply analytical, fluent in experimentation, partner closely with data scientists, and have a track record of building growth loops
  • Core product expertise: Multiple years in core product roles where you solved specific user needs and pain points and shipped features explicitly aimed at addressing them
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ills
  • A scrappy, self-starting approach—comfortable operating with ambiguity and no established playbook
